4 Mounting SMA Solar Technology America LLC
32 SI4548-6048-US-BE-en-21 Operating Manual
Mount the Sunny Island in such a way that the display is at eye level in order to allow the
operating state to be read at all times.
Mount vertically or tilted backwards by max. 45°.
Never mount the device with a forward tilt.
Do not mount in a horizontal position.
The connection area must not point upwards.
The room air can have a humidity of up to 100%, but this must not be condensing.
In a living area, do not mount the unit on
plasterboard walls, etc. in order to avoid audible
vibrations.
The Sunny Island can make noises when in use
which can be considered a nuisance when installed
in a living area.
Maintain the minimum distances to walls, other
devices and objects as represented in the
illustration.
In order to maintain sufficient ventilation, when
installing the device a minimum clearance of 12 in
(30 cm) at the sides and top must be maintained.
Operation and reading are made easier by
installing the Sunny Island with its display at eye
level and by keeping a distance of 20 in (50 cm)
from the front.
All cables are routed to the outside through the
underside of the enclosure. Therefore a minimum
clearance of 20 in (50 cm) must be observed here.
